Sean P. Hedican is a scholar working on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, Surgery and Pediatrics, Perinatology and Child Health. According to data from OpenAlex, Sean P. Hedican has authored 77 papers receiving a total of 2.6k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 49 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, 32 papers in Surgery and 25 papers in Pediatrics, Perinatology and Child Health. Recurrent topics in Sean P. Hedican's work include Pediatric Urology and Nephrology Studies (25 papers), Renal cell carcinoma treatment (21 papers) and Kidney Stones and Urolithiasis Treatments (18 papers). Sean P. Hedican is often cited by papers focused on Pediatric Urology and Nephrology Studies (25 papers), Renal cell carcinoma treatment (21 papers) and Kidney Stones and Urolithiasis Treatments (18 papers). Sean P. Hedican collaborates with scholars based in United States, Belgium and Türkiye. Sean P. Hedican's co-authors include Stephen Y. Nakada, Jonathan W. Simons, Fred T. Lee, Steven G. Docimo, Gyan Pareek, Daniel J. George, Steven Piantadosi, Joel B. Nelson, Mario A. Eisenberger and A. Hari Reddi and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ature Medicine, S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ología and Cancer.
